Short biography
McDonald was a conservative American congressman, known both as the second president of the John Birch Society and for being the only sitting member of Congress to be killed by the Soviet Union during the Cold War. McDonald's plane (Korean Air Lines Flight 007) was shot down over the Sea of Japan in 1983 when a navigational error caused the plane to enter Soviet air space. All crew and passengers were assumed to be killed. McDonald's remains were never identified.
